Seminar in Roja Explores Opportunities for Sustainable Coastal Development; 18.11.2025

On 14 November 2025, a seminar organised by the Kurzeme Business Club of the Latvian Chamber of Commerce and Industry took place in Roja, focusing on the development potential of coastal areas and related business opportunities. The event brought together entrepreneurs, municipal representatives and non-governmental organisations to discuss how to support entrepreneurship and sustainable development along the Kurzeme coast.

Participants gained insights into the principles of coastal governance, sustainable spatial planning and potential cooperation models between businesses and municipalities. Anete Jansone, Project Manager at Kurzeme Planning Region, presented current coastal development trends and possible future scenarios based on regional and national planning documents. She also introduced the COREEL project, highlighting its role in strengthening research, cooperation and sustainable management of coastal cultural heritage in Kurzeme.

Discussions revealed strong interest among entrepreneurs in developing new services, improving infrastructure and strengthening cooperation with local authorities. At the same time, participants emphasised that coastal development must remain balanced, responsible and aligned with environmental protection and community interests.
